usb: atm: ueagle-atm: use dev_dbg() for 'device found' message

Convert dev_info() to dev_dbg().

Per 'Documentation/process/coding-style.rst':

  13) Printing kernel messages

  ...  When drivers are working properly they are quiet,
  so prefer to use dev_dbg/pr_debug unless something is wrong.

While in there, correct the verb form and add 'with' for clarity.
